Description

This form states that the guarantor unconditionally and absolutely guarantees to payee(s), jointly and severally, the full and prompt payment and performance of any and all account receivable charges by the customer incurred to the payee, including collections fees and reasonable attorneys' fees, up to a certain maximum amount. Pennsylvania Accounts Receivable — Guaranty is a specialized financial agreement that provides assurance for Pennsylvania businesses against potential losses incurred due to non-payment by their customers. This type of guarantee serves as a safeguard for businesses in the state, ensuring the timely collection of outstanding accounts receivable. The purpose of a Pennsylvania Accounts Receivable — Guaranty is to mitigate credit risks for businesses operating in various industries such as manufacturing, wholesale, retail, and service providers. By securing this guarantee, companies can streamline their cash flow management and minimize the negative impact of unpaid invoices on their overall financial health. Different types of Pennsylvania Accounts Receivable — Guaranty may include: 1. Full Guaranty: Under this type of guarantee, the financial institution assumes responsibility for the complete non-payment risk associated with the accounts receivable. In the event of default, the guarantor will compensate the business for the outstanding amount, ensuring the business is not financially impacted. 2. Limited Guaranty: This variant of Pennsylvania Accounts Receivable — Guaranty provides coverage for a specific percentage or amount of the accounts receivable. The guarantor's liability is limited to the predetermined coverage limit, and any losses beyond that threshold are borne by the business. 3. Recourse Guaranty: In a recourse guaranty, the guarantor retains the right to demand repayment from the business in case of non-payment by the customer. This type of guarantee offers businesses an added level of protection, but in return, the financial institution may charge a lower fee or offer more favorable terms. 4. Non-Recourse Guaranty: Unlike a recourse guaranty, a non-recourse guaranty relieves the business from liability for non-payment by the customer. The financial institution assumes full responsibility for any losses incurred, providing businesses with peace of mind and allowing them to focus on their core operations. When considering Pennsylvania Accounts Receivable — Guaranty options, businesses should evaluate factors such as the financial stability of the guarantor, coverage limits, fees, and any additional services offered. This financial tool can complement existing credit management strategies and help Pennsylvania businesses maintain a healthy cash flow through reliable receivables' collection. In conclusion, Pennsylvania Accounts Receivable — Guaranty safeguards businesses in the state against potential losses arising from non-payment by their customers. Different types of guarantees exist, including full guaranty, limited guaranty, recourse guaranty, and non-recourse guaranty. Choosing the right type of guarantee is crucial for businesses to effectively manage credit risks and ensure stable cash flow.
